On Friday, Mozilla Foundation released early developer release of the mobile version of Firefox, for testing purposes only, intended to:

  • get wider community feedback on our approach to the user experience
  • engage Mozilla community teams, including localizers, add-on developers, and testers
  • get feedback from Web developers

This first alpha release is available for the OS2008 (“Maemo”) software platforms that runs on the Nokia N810 Internet Tablets. Here is a download link to install Fennec to Nokia N810. Mozilla also released Fennec’s desktop PC version. All the versions can be downloaded from here.


Few details of Fennec from it’s homepage:

  • Easy navigation to Web content:
    • Bookmarks, including tags
    • Smart URL bar (“awesome bar”)
    • Tabbed browsing with thumbnail images
    • Integrated Web search – built into the URL bar
    • Easy access to multiple search engines
  • Web content:
    • Maximize content by auto-hiding controls and URL bar
    • Zoom in and out
  • Security:
    • Instant Web site ID (“Larry”)
    • Password manager
    • Popup blocker
    • Clear private data
  • Devices services integration:
    • Click on a phone number to initiate a call
    • JavaScript API to get device location
